Output 34ac38b10434ab408286c6e9e97502412e0680b9e646769822d89bd5f51e3559:0

value
42127206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ae8b8da369f8823d17401d6f6bf693f005473f8 OP_EQUALVERIFY OP_CHECKSIG
address
LP8qS5o29NhmrRvwfqA9WDJHyhT5EqyhVz
transaction
34ac38b10434ab408286c6e9e97502412e0680b9e646769822d89bd5f51e3559
spent
true